Job Description
**Job Summary** The Legal Counsel role is designed for a qualified attorney with at least 6 years (post\-JD) of legal experience either at a law firm or in\-house. The role provides strategic legal support across a broad spectrum of corporate, commercial, regulatory, and other legal matters, serving as a key advisor and subject matter expert in at least two areas of law (preferably one in employment law) to internal stakeholders with little supervision. The role involves such responsibilities as drafting, reviewing, and negotiating complex contracts, analyzing and advising on compliance matters, and supporting compliance/corporate governance initiatives. The role may also assist more senior attorneys with M\&A transactions and other important projects. The role involves leading projects in commercial transactions, employment law, data privacy, litigation, and intellectual property issues. The role requires strong business acumen and the ability to deliver practical legal solutions that align with organizational goals. Additional responsibilities include developing and delivering legal training programs, managing outside counsel, and contributing to the enhancement of legal processes and policies. The role is a member of the Group Legal Department and reports directly to the Vice President \& Head of Legal \- North America. **What You Will Be Doing** * Provide proactive, pragmatic legal advice on a wide range of corporate, commercial, regulatory, and compliance matters. * Draft, review, and negotiate complex contracts, including supply, distribution, licensing, procurement, and technology agreements. * Advise on compliance, corporate governance, and risk management initiatives; develop and implement legal policies, playbooks, and training. * Lead small to mid\-level M\&A transactions, including due diligence, deal structuring, agreements and post\-merger integration. * Lead small to mid\-level litigation, dispute resolution, and regulatory investigations, while closely managing outside counsel. * Draft documents and communicate with clarity and precision. * Serve and be responsible as the lead legal contract for one or more business units or functional areas. * Mentor and provide guidance to Associate Legal Counsel; review their work as needed. * Lead strategic legal projects and continuous improvement initiatives within the legal department. * Serve as a legal resource to internal stakeholders to understand and support their needs and priorities. * Stay abreast of legal and industry developments, proactively identifying risks and opportunities for the business.
